Strongly Coupled Charged Scalar inBandTDecays

Abstract
Limits on charged-scalar Yukawa couplings from τ and B decays are discussed. They (and other existing limits) are consistent with "strong" couplings (∼1 for the third generation) even if the lightest scalar mass is in the range 20 GeVMφ100 GeV but saturated in this case. B(BτνX) and (for Mφ>mt) B(TτνX) may be then as large as 30% and 70%, respectively. Both for Mφ<mt and Mφ>mt the potentially possible top-quark signature in pp¯ collisions is τ+2 jets final state.
